Budget 2018: Centre earmarks Rs 10 bn for fixing Delhi-NCR's pollution woes
so as to easy up the capital's air, or at the least make it more breathable, and quit the residents' annual workout of choking beneath a blanket of smog, the Centre has decided to earmark Rs 10 billion (1,000 crore) in the upcoming price range to lessen the exercise of stubble burning in Delhi's neighbouring states like Punjab and Haryana, the times of India mentioned on Thursday.

How will the Centre placed a prevent to stubble burning, an issue that proved to be contentious and noticed the Delhi and Punjab governments juggle blame remaining yr, and get farmers to locate higher ways to take away agricultural waste? the solution lies in subsidies for stated farmers. The national daily said that extra Solicitor widespread A N S Nadkarni informed a Bench of Justices Madan B Lokur and Deepak Gupta that the Centre might offer subsidies to farmers to buy machines like glad Seeder and Rotavators. these machines are meant to help farmers get rid of farm residue without burning it. in keeping with the file, these machines sow wheat into the soil at the same time as simultaneously reducing and lifting rice straw. As a end result, the stubble remains inside the fields with out hampering the sowing of a new crop.
